黑狐家游戏

深入解析数据库关系表,构建高效数据模型的关键要素,数据库关系表怎么建立

欧气 0 0

本文目录导读:

深入解析数据库关系表,构建高效数据模型的关键要素,数据库关系表怎么建立

图片来源于网络,如有侵权联系删除

  1. 数据库关系表的定义
  2. 数据库关系表的组成
  3. 数据库关系表的特点
  4. 数据库关系表的关系
  5. 数据库关系表的优化

随着信息技术的飞速发展,数据库已成为现代社会不可或缺的核心组成部分,数据库关系表作为数据库的核心概念,承载着数据存储、管理、查询和操作的重要任务,本文将从数据库关系表的定义、组成、特点、关系及优化等方面进行深入解析,旨在帮助读者更好地理解数据库关系表,构建高效的数据模型。

数据库关系表的定义

数据库关系表,又称关系模式,是数据库中的一种数据结构,用于描述实体之间的关系,它将实体按照一定的规则组织起来,形成一个有序的集合,关系表是数据库的核心,所有的数据都存储在关系表中。

数据库关系表的组成

1、属性:关系表中的每个元素称为属性,它描述了实体的某个特征,在学生关系表中,姓名、性别、年龄等都是属性。

2、域:属性值的范围称为域,姓名的域是字符串,年龄的域是整数。

3、主键:关系表中的主键是唯一标识每个实体的属性或属性组合,主键具有唯一性、非空性和稳定性等特点。

4、外键:外键是关系表中用于建立两个关系表之间联系的属性,外键指向另一个关系表的主键,实现了数据的关联。

数据库关系表的特点

1、结构简单:关系表采用二维表格的形式,结构简单明了,便于理解和操作。

深入解析数据库关系表,构建高效数据模型的关键要素,数据库关系表怎么建立

图片来源于网络,如有侵权联系删除

2、灵活性:关系表可以方便地添加、删除和修改属性,适应不同的业务需求。

3、数据独立性:关系表可以独立于应用程序存在,降低了数据与应用程序之间的耦合度。

4、易于扩展:关系表可以通过添加新的属性和关系来扩展功能,满足不断变化的需求。

数据库关系表的关系

1、一对一关系:一个实体只能与另一个实体建立唯一的关系。

2、一对多关系:一个实体可以与多个实体建立关系,而另一个实体只能与一个实体建立关系。

3、多对多关系:多个实体可以与多个实体建立关系。

数据库关系表的优化

1、确定合适的字段类型:根据数据的特点选择合适的字段类型,提高数据存储效率。

深入解析数据库关系表,构建高效数据模型的关键要素,数据库关系表怎么建立

图片来源于网络,如有侵权联系删除

2、优化索引:合理设置索引,提高查询速度。

3、避免冗余数据:通过规范化关系表,减少数据冗余。

4、合理设计外键:外键的设计应遵循参照完整性原则,确保数据的正确性。

数据库关系表是数据库的核心概念,掌握关系表的设计和优化技巧对于构建高效的数据模型具有重要意义,本文从关系表的定义、组成、特点、关系及优化等方面进行了详细解析,希望对读者有所帮助,在实际应用中,我们需要根据业务需求不断优化关系表,以实现数据的高效存储和管理。

标签: #数据库关系表

黑狐家游戏
  • 评论列表

留言评论